MARTIN MIDSTREAM PARTNERS REPORTS
2013 FIRST QUARTER FINANCIAL RESULTS
KILGORE, Texas, May 6, 2013 (GlobeNewswire) -- Martin Midstream Partners L.P. (Nasdaq: MMLP) (the "Partnership") announced today its financ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2013.
The Partnership reported net income for the first quarter of 2013 of $16.6 million, or $0.61 per limited partner unit. This compared to net income for the first quarter of 2012 of $12.5 million, or $0.39 per limited partner unit.
The Partnership reported income from continuing operations for the first quarter of 2013 of $16.6 million, or $0.61 per limited partner unit. This compared to income from continuing operations for the first quarter of 2012 of $10.7 million, or $0.33 per limited partner unit. The Partnership reported income from discontinued operations for the first quarter of 2012 of $1.7 million, or $0.06 per limited partner unit. Revenues for the first quarter of 2013 were $433.7 million compared to $348.3 million for the first quarter of 2012.
The Partnership's distributable cash flow for the first quarter of 2013 was $28.9 million. Ruben Martin, President and Chief Executive Officer of Martin Midstream GP LLC, the general partner of Martin Midstream Partners, said, "During the first quarter 2013, the Partnership generated record cash flow. We finished the quarter with a strong 1.38 times distribution coverage ratio. On a fully diluted basis, our distribution coverage ratio would have been 1.27 times assuming the incentive distribution rights were in effect for the quarter. The general partner has agreed to forego its right to receive $18.0 million in incentive distributions in support of our natural gas storage investment.
"Our Partnership saw positive results across multiple segments during the first quarter. This included strong performance in the wholesale butane division of our Natural Gas Services segment. The market remained strong as the gasoline blending season carried over from the fourth quarter. In our Sulfur Services segment, we benefited from another strong quarter from our fertilizer division. In the Terminalling and Storage segment, our second consecutive quarter with an integrated lubricant packaging platform showed great results and is ahead of planned cash flow year to date. We continue to be excited about the potential growth of our lubricant packaging business and are committed to its success. Lastly, we believe our Marine Transportation segment is also currently well-positioned. While inland demand remains strong, utilization is currently also strong in our offshore division, which has historically had more volatile cash flow.
"Also, the first quarter 2013 was the first full operational quarter under contract for our Corpus Christi crude oil terminal facility. Throughput to date at the terminal has exceeded plan on the first six tanks and generated strong cash flow. Currently, we are making progress securing a contract for the final 300,000 barrels of storage for which construction will commence soon. The additional storage is anticipated to be operational in early 2014.
"Finally, the Partnership completed its largest financing transaction by closing on a new $600 million credit facility during the first quarter. Our new credit facility provides ample liquidity to enable us to continue our growth initiatives."

About Martin Midstream Partners
The Partnership is a publicly traded limited partnership with a diverse set of operations focused primarily in the United States Gulf Coast region. The Partnership's primary business segments include: terminalling and storage services for petroleum products and by-products including the refining, blending and packaging of finished products; natural gas services, including liquids distribution services and natural gas storage; sulfur and sulfur-based products processing, manufacturing, marketing and distribution; and marine transportation services for petroleum products and by-products. The Partnership is based in Kilgore, Texas and was founded in 2002.

Use of Non-GAAP Financial Information
The Partnership reports its financial results in accordance with U.S. GAAP. However, from time to time, the Partnership uses certain non-GAAP financial measures such as distributable cash flow because the Partnership's management believes that this measure may provide users of this financial information with meaningful comparisons between current results and prior reported results and a meaningful measure of Partnership's cash available to pay distributions. Distributable cash flow should not be considered an alternative to cash flow from operating activities or any other measure of financial performance in accordance with GAAP. Distributable cash flow is not intended to represent cash flows for the period, nor is it presented as an alternative to income from continuing operations. Furthermore, it should not be seen as
a measure of liquidity or a substitute for comparable metrics prepared in accordance with GAAP. This information may constitute non-GAAP financial measures within the meaning of Regulation G adopted by the Securities and Exchange Commission. Accordingly, the Partnership has presented herein, and will present in other information it publishes that contains this non-GAAP financial measure, a reconciliation of this measure to the most directly comparable GAAP financial measure.
The Partnership has included below a table entitled “Distributable Cash Flow” in order to show the components of this non-GAAP financial measure and its reconciliation to the most comparable GAAP measure. The Partnership calculates distributable cash flow as follows: net income (as reported in statements of operations); plus depreciation and amortization; less gain on sale of property, plant and equipment; plus amortization of debt discount and amortization of deferred debt issuance costs; less payments of installment notes payable and capital lease obligations; plus return of investments from unconsolidated entities (all as reported in statements of cash flows); plus equity in losses of unconsolidated entities (as reported in statements of operations); less maintenance capital expenditures (as reported under the caption “Liquidity and Capital Resources” in the Partnership's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q filed with the SEC on May 6, 2013); plus unit-based compensation (as reported in statements of changes in capital).
